Product Attributes
- Product Status: Active
- Connector Style: QMA
- Connector Type: Plug, Male Pin
- Contact Termination: Solder
- Shield Termination: Crimp
- Impedance: 50Ohm
- Mounting Type: Free Hanging (In-Line)
- Mounting Feature: -
- Cable Group: RG-142B, 223, 400
- Fastening Type: Snap-On
- Frequency - Max: 18 GHz
- Number of Ports: 1
- Features: -
- Housing Color: Silver
- Ingress Protection: -
- Center Contact Material: Brass
